The Nothing Phone (2a) Plus is now available for pre-order in Europe, starting at €429, with shipments beginning on September 10.
The Nothing Phone (2a) Plus was announced in July. It released in some markets a month later, but not in continental Europe. At this year’s IFA event in Berlin, Nothing revealed that it’s now coming to Europe.
Pre-orders start today, September 6, with sales and shipments beginning on September 10. The phone will be available at major retailers like Amazon, Saturn, and MediaMarkt.
The Nothing Phone (2a) Plus has two colors: Black and Grey. It has one version with 12GB of RAM and 256GB of storage. The 8GB/256GB option is not available for now.
In the UK, the phone is priced at £399. In Switzerland, it’s CHF 399, and in the Nordics, it costs €459. In Austria, Belgium, Germany, the Netherlands, and Spain, it will be €429. Other parts of Europe, like France, Italy, and Portugal, will pay €20 more.
